Louisa County was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their 11th straight defeat dating back to last season. They came up short against the Eastern View Cyclones, falling 62-38. The game marked the Lions' lowest-scoring contest so far this season.
Louisa County's loss dropped their record down to 0-8. As for Eastern View, the victory was the fourth in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 7-1.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Louisa County won't have much time to rest: their next match is against Fauquier at 3:00 p.m. on Saturday. Fauquier knows how to get points on the board -- the squad has finished with 55 points or more in their past three contests -- so hopefully Louisa County likes a good challenge. As for Eastern View, they will face off against Chancellor at 6:30 p.m. on Friday. Chancellor is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 58 points per game this season.
